在Kubernetes(K8S)中,我们经常需要使用Git作为版本控制工具来管理应用程序的源代码,但是有时我们可能需要删除本地缓存以清除不必要的文件或目录。本文将教您如何在Git删除缓存,以确保代码库的整洁和准确性。 ### 删除Git缓存的步骤 下表展示了删除Git缓存的步骤: | 步骤 | 描述 | |------|------------
原创 2024-04-30 10:45:15
239阅读
删除缓冲区中的文件 git rm --cached "文件路径",不删除物理文件,仅将该文件从缓存删除git rm --f "文件路径",不仅将该文件从缓存删除,还会将物理文件删除(不会回收到垃圾桶); 如果一个文件已经add到暂存区,还没有 commit,此时如果不想要这个文件了,有两种方
转载 2020-10-27 21:30:00
6368阅读
2评论
场景一使用git的http协议去clone仓库的代码时,第一次弹框提示输入账号密码的时候输错
原创 2023-06-05 14:41:58
1291阅读
PR剪辑小问题汇总-老手剪辑师也会遇到的小问题1、播放视频时字幕不清晰,停止时清晰是为什么?因为PR会根据电脑资源占用自行播放时降低分辨率,保证实时预览,出现类似情况是因为实时渲染速度不够,是正常现象,只要保证输出时是完整分辨率即可。2、PR导出的视频显示不出字幕?在导出设置中找到效果视频那一栏点击字幕,将导出选项改为将字幕录制到视频即可。3、PR导出的视频比估计文件大很多,怎么解决?关闭硬件加速
浏览器是人们在网络生活中不可缺少的存在,我们使用各种浏览器上网的时候,可能会出现各种程序出错的问题。或者,可能使用浏览器的时间就了,发现电脑有点卡顿,这时候就需要情况缓存了。那么,如何清理电脑浏览器的缓存呢?下面分享4款常用浏览器清理缓存的方法。一、微软Edge浏览器清理缓存的方法1、打开Edge浏览器,点击右上角的设置及其他(三个点);2、点击【历史记录】,然后点击弹出窗口右上角的三个点(更多选
实现思路:  简单描述一下,通过遍历获取所有Redis的key值,有两种方式,分别是StringRedisTemplate的delete方法和RedisTemplate的delete方法,这里我是调用RedisTemplate对象的delete方法进行删除。参考代码:package com.example.business.controller; import com.example.busin
转载 2023-07-04 18:18:13
513阅读
/** * 根据key前缀批量删除缓存 * * @param key * @return */ public static Boolean batchDel(String key, RedisTemplate jedis) { Boolean flag = false; try { S
转载 2023-06-14 22:07:15
238阅读
参考 github 的帮助:https://help.github.com/articles/remove-sensitive-data步骤一: 从你的资料库中清除文件以Windows下为例(Linux类似), 打开项目的Git Bash,使用命令: git filter-branch --force --index-filter 'git rm --cached --ignore-unmatch
转载 2024-03-13 09:17:19
264阅读
Git中,删除也是一个修改操作,我们实战一下,先添加一个新文件test.txt到Git并且提交:$ git add test.txt$ git commit -m "add test.txt"[master a5abce6] add test.txt 1 file changed, 0 insertions(+), 0 deletions(-) create mode 100644 t...
原创 2022-06-06 12:18:36
160阅读
清空git缓存 一、总结 一句话总结: git rm --cached "文件路径",不删除物理文件,仅将该文件从缓存删除git rm --f "文件路径",不仅将该文件从缓存删除,还会将物理文件删除(不会回收到垃圾桶); 二、清空git缓存 转自或参考:git删除缓存区中文件 https:
转载 2020-10-09 14:41:00
1984阅读
git rm -r --cached .git add . git commit -m 'update .gitignore' 读了下git文档,才发现,这些东西其实很简单,很容易理解。cached其实就是暂存区,然后一个是工作的目录,你的工作目录的东西做出修改时,会和缓存区进行对比,因此你git
原创 2022-07-05 13:56:16
1509阅读
清除git缓存 git config --local --unset credential.helper git config --global --unset credential.helper git config --system --unset credential.helper 保存git
原创 2022-07-13 11:13:58
1854阅读
基于 GitFlow 工作流,可能某个提交(commit)导致了 bug,或者有多个提交需要返工,此时你就会用到删除提交。 接下来的内容都基于下面这张 git log 提交记录图来写。 git log 删除最后的提交当需要删除最新的提交、或最最近的几个提交。比如删除 1 或者 1~3 的提交,使用 git reset命令。 我们需要关注一下 git reset的 --hard
转载 2023-10-04 22:56:50
154阅读
平时我们在使用git的时候,很少去关注其配置是如何,而在实际开发中,对git config这个命令的使用也并不是很多,但是配置对一个程序和项目来说都是很重要的,我们今天来看看git的配置以及git config的初步应用。    1. git config简介 我们知道config是配置的意思,那么git config命令就是对git进行一些配置。而配置一般都是写在配
转载 2024-02-08 15:32:32
176阅读
写在前面大家一定遇到过在使用Git时,不小心将一个很大的文件添加到库中,即使删除,记录中还是保存了这个文件。以后不管是拷贝,还是push/pull都比较麻烦。今天在上传工程到github上,发现最大只能上传100MB大小文件,在本地git库中有一个150MB文件,虽然已经删除,但还保存了记录。下面教大家如何从库中彻底删除无效大文件。删除大文件方法很简单,就是先找到大文件对象再删除。先提交所有更改$
没用的目录删除文件删除 commit 删除文件1、文件已提交到仓库:1. git rm <file> // 从工作区和暂存区删除 2. git commit -m "" // 再次提交到仓库2、只删除暂存区中的文件,本地不做修改:git rm --cached <file>3、恢复本地被误删除的文件:git checkout -- <file> // 将
转载 2024-04-16 20:37:32
43阅读
代码如下:## 注意Windows下用双引号 git filter-branch --index-filter 'git rm -r --cached --ignore-unmatch path/to/your/file' HEAD git push origin master --force rm -rf .git/refs/original/ git reflog expire --expir
转载 2024-04-29 10:23:05
130阅读
一、删除已经提交到github上的缓存文件1.先从github上拉取 git pull 2.删除本地缓存 git rm -r --cached target 3.push到github git push origin master 4.修改.gitignore文件,添加要过滤的文件夹或文件类型 如,增加/target/ 5.添加修改 git add .gitignore 6.提交修改 gi
转载 2024-04-08 06:41:36
54阅读
git命令使用 删除已经add进缓存的文件在工作中遇到一个问题,使用git add . 想把很多修改文件一起加进去,不慎把untrack的文件例如bin/ 下的文件和gen/下的文件等不需要check的文件也加了进去。 这时如果要执行git reset --hard +SHA1号的话,之前的改动文件 ...
转载 2021-09-26 15:20:00
319阅读
2评论
我们使用Git命令去clone Gitlab仓库的代码时,第一次弹框提示输入账号密码的时候输错了,然后后面就一直拒绝,不再重复提示输入账号密码,怎么破? git报错信息 git报错信息 运行一下命令缓存输入的用户名和密码: 清除掉缓存git中的用户名和密码 完美解决!
转载 2019-09-26 09:06:00
696阅读
2评论
  • 1
  • 2
  • 3
  • 4
  • 5